1

Dojoのローカリゼーションを設定しています

$locale = new Zend_Locale();
$locale->setLocale('de_AT');

$this->view->dojo()->setDjConfigOption('locale', 'de_AT')

ZendFrameworkで。

しかし、(Zend_Dojo_Formクラスで)CurrencyTextBoxでフォームを使用する場合、コンマの代わりに小数点を入力するためにドットを使用する必要があります。これは間違っています。

これが正しく機能しない理由はありますか?これはDojoのバグですか?

4

2 に答える 2

0

行は次のようになります(ATは大文字ではありません):

$this->view->dojo()->setDjConfigOption('locale', 'de_at')
于 2013-01-17T00:29:53.743 に答える
0

正しい構文は次のとおりです。

$this->view->dojo()->setDjConfigOption('locale', 'de-at') 
于 2013-05-24T14:44:24.373 に答える